Dietmar Hamann believes Tottenham Hotspur’s Dele Alli could end up like Arsenal’s Alex Oxlade-Chamberlain and Theo Walcott.

Dietmar Hamann has warned that Tottenham Hotspur’s Dele Alli still has a lot to prove.

Hamann argued that Alli would not get into Germany’s line-up at this moment in time, ahead of the likes of Marco Reus, Julian Draxler and Mesut Ozil.

And when challenged on his opinion, the former Liverpool man suggested that Alli could yet go the same way as Arsenal’s Alex Oxlade-Chamberlain or Theo Walcott.

Oxlade-Chamberlain and Walcott both are considered not to have totally fulfilled their potential while with Arsenal.

Alli, though, has shown signs that he could turn into a global superstar in his first two seasons at Tottenham.

The England international midfielder has enjoyed a rapid rise, and is already playing a key role at Spurs.

Alli has scored 14 goals in 27 matches while playing for Tottenham, and he has also claimed four assists.

Alli looks likely to start for England tonight, when they take on Germany in a friendly match.
